灌溉水质综合评价的熵权可拓模型

摘    要:针对现有单项灌溉水质评价方法评价指标界限刚性量化的缺点,提出了基于熵权的物元可拓综合评价模型,将熵权系数法和物元可拓方法有机结合,不仅解决了灌溉水质单项指标评价结果的不确定性和不相容性问题,而且在确定指标权重时,引入熵权系数概念,克服了传统可拓评价方法在确定评价指标权重时的主观因素的影响。结果表明,该模型的评价结果与属性综合评价法及人工神经网络评价法的评价结果完全一致。从而验证了该模型的合理、简便和实用。
